Deah, a proud fifth generation Texas native, is a graduate of Southern Methodist University (B.S., M.A.) and currently pursuing her Ph.D. in History at the University of North Texas. She is the founder of a successful touring company, Soul of DFW specializing in cultural tours around the Dallas/Fort Worth metroplex.
She has also written a book on the history of soul food and its influences that you can buy on Amazon.
Educating the community about Black culture and curating creative experiences is her passion!
A born storyteller, Deah enjoys cooking, writing and travel.

Jill is a commercial advertising photographer. She has a bachelors degree from Baylor University in Journalism and heralds from San Francisco, CA. Both mediums stem from her love of telling people's stories and learning from history.
She feels strongly that the voices from our past must be held tightly, as many soldiers and revolutionaries slip away to the generations. She has jumped onto this project to be part of the rescue effort of these narratives and to share hope and vision with the younger generation.
When she's not immersed in her art, Jill loves spending time on the Pacific coast in the fog.
